A piece of mapping paper taped over your base plan can be made use of for sketching your ideas for the wide, general usage areas. The general public area is typically the location in front of the house that is visible to the general public. Your home is the main focus of this component of the landscape.




A couple of bright blossoms and specimen or unusual plants might do this. A stroll leading from your drive to the front door will certainly likewise assist guests. Layout the stroll large enough for 2 people to walk pleasantly side-by-side. The stroll needs to provide a rather direct path with probably a few small contours for passion.


The exclusive location should also serve as a place to captivate guests and a place for rest, relaxation, and recreation. To fulfill these desires, you may include a patio, terrace, pool, grass, color trees, or a greenhouse.

The personal location is also the area for your preferred flowers, blooming bushes, and roses. This is where your household and their guests invest one of the most time and can enjoy them to their max. You may additionally consist of a couple of specimen plants in a border or leave a vista open up to enjoy remote views.


The service area is the area for the rubbish cans, air conditioning condenser, an utility structure, fire wood pile, compost container, or a veggie garden. These basic landscape areas ought to associate to each various other in much the same method that areas in the house are associated.

Each location is often separated to some level by plants or physical limits, a lot as spaces of a home are divided by walls. Allow for motion in between them, as in a yard or stroll from the front backyard to the back.

An understanding of these principles can keep you from creating a landscape monster rather of the elegance that you fantasize around. Unity, simpleness, range, balance, sequence, and range are terms often related to art. These terms are used to guide an imaginative expression, and in landscape layout, they are simply as vital as in various other art types.

Various parts of the landscape ought to associate with each other. You need to obtain a feeling of visual circulation from one part of the landscape to the various other to make sure that attributes of one part remind you of another. Some repeating of an attribute of the landscape is good, however it needs to not be reached the point of dullness.


For instance, a red shade might be used as a theme, but you might make use of plants with red vegetation as well as other plants with similarly colored flowers or foliage. The plants would certainly remain in various areas of the landscape, but the color style joins the total design. Other themes, such as kinds of plants, curves or straight lines, and building and construction materials, can be made use of to develop unity in the layout.






When creating a household landscape, one of the most essential action is to place a strategy on paper. Creating a master plan will certainly save you time and money and is extra most likely to result in an effective style. A master plan is created with the 'design procedure': a detailed method that considers the ecological conditions, your desires, and the elements and concepts of style.

The five steps of the layout process include: 1) carrying out a site supply and analysis, 2) identifying your demands, 3) creating practical layouts, 4) you could try these out developing conceptual style strategies, and 5) drawing a final style strategy. The first three actions develop the aesthetic, practical, and gardening requirements for the style. The last 2 steps then use those needs to the creation of the last landscape plan.


This is a critical step for both plant option and positioning and finding household tasks and functions - Landscapers. It is necessary because the exact same environment conditions that impact the plantstemperature, moisture, rainfall, wind, and sunlightalso affect you, the individual. The following action is to make a list of your requirements and desiresthis aids you determine exactly how your lawn and landscape will certainly be used


The useful diagram is then utilized to locate the activity areas on the website and from this layout a conceptual plan is created. The last step is a last design that includes all the hardscape and growing information that are necessary for setup. The type of soil determines the nutrients and dampness offered to the plants. It is always best to make use of plants that will grow in the existing dirt. Although soil can be changed, amendment is often pricey and the majority of times inefficient. Existing greenery can offer ideas to the dirt kind. Where plants grow well, note the dirt conditions and make use of plants with similar expanding requirements.

Topography and drainage must additionally be noted and all drain troubles corrected in the suggested layout. An excellent design will relocate water away from the home and re-route it to various other locations of the yard. Climate issues begin with temperature level: plants must be able to make it through the typical high and, most importantly, the typical low temperatures for the region.
